O’Connor Professional Group Webinar – Collegial Conversations with Diana Clark – Diversity and Inclusion in the Workplace

In this week’s Collegial Conversation with Diana Clark, Zina Navarro Rodriguez joins Diana Clark to discuss the need for diversity in leadership and clinical positions and how creating safe and welcoming spaces for BIPOC and LGBTQ+ can lead to impactful change.

Zina Navarro Rodriguez, MSW, MCAP, CDE is a global speaker, diversity, equity, and inclusion executive, behavioral health care specialist, and mental health advocate. Zina is the co-founder of Z&D Consulting and has over 25 years of marketing and social work experience in marketing and behavioral health care. Zina has a passion and a mission to create inviting, intentional, and inclusive healing spaces for individuals to achieve mental wellness while creating pathways for success for individuals from underrepresented communities.
